Eric Wood wrote:

> I may be dreaming but is there some up-to-date RH 7.3 iso's that  
> already incorporate most of the package updates?  Are do I have to  
> do a three-step process of:
> 1) installing the stock 7.3
> 2) update all rpms RedHat published
> 3) configure yum and update all the Legacy updates.
>
> -or-
>
> Does a mirrored updates directory, (ie, http://www.gtlib.gatech.edu/ 
> pub/fedoralegacy/redhat/7.3/updates/) contain *all* 7.3 updates for  
> the stock 7.3 cd's?
>
> 1) installing the stock 7.3
> 2) configure yum and update all the Legacy updates (which include  
> all RH updates).
>
> If this is true, I don't think this fact is stressed enough on the  
> download page (http://fedoralegacy.org/download/).

Yes, the Legacy updates directory contains both types of updates. You  
can tell from the package names, the legacy ones have the word legacy  
included.
